India’s Covid-19 tally on Thursday crossed 9.73 million after 31,521 new cases were logged in the last 24 hours. The total cases now include 372,293 active cases, over 9.25 million recoveries and 141,772 deaths, according to the Union health ministry’s dashboard.
Maharashtra, Delhi and Kerala continue to be worst affected from the pandemic. Delhi’s Covid tally is nearing the 600,000-mark with 20,546 active cases and 569,216 recoveries. Health minister Satyendar Jain said the national capital recorded 50 deaths on Wednesday, the lowest since November 1 and added it was emerging victorious in the fight against the pandemic. In a series of tweets, he also said that for the first time in Delhi, 'more than 2,500 ICU beds' were vacant for infected patients.

Meanwhile, documents related to the Pfizer/BioNTech’s Covid-19 vaccine were hacked during a cyber attack at the EU regulator, the organisation said. Documents relating to the vaccine candidate had been accessed, but that no systems have been breached in connection with this incident, it added.

Geneva reopens restaurant as coronavirus cases dip
With most of Switzerland preparing for tighter lockdown restrictions because of Covid-19, the region of Geneva is going in the other direction — allowing restaurants to reopen on Thursday after a drop in cases from one of the world's highest rates of infection roughly a month ago, reports AP.
Odisha registers 343 fresh Covid-19 cases
Odisha's Covid-19 caseload on Thursday climbed to 3,22,642 after 343 more people tested positive for the infection, while five fresh fatalities pushed the toll in the coastal state to 1,794, a senior health department official said, reports PTI.

Indonesia secures 155.5 million Covid vaccine doses
Indonesia has secured 155.5 million doses of coronavirus vaccines and is seeking another 116 million through deals with Pfizer, AstraZeneca and global vaccine programme COVAX, government data showed on Thursday, reports Reuters.
South Korea scrambles to build container hospital beds to fight third Covid-19 wave
South Korea authorities scrambled on Thursday to build hospital beds in shipping containers to ease strains on medical facilities stretched by the latest coronavirus wave, which shows little sign of abating with 682 new cases, reports Reuters.
India crosses 15-crore mark of coronavirus tests
India's cumulative tests for detection of Covid-19 has crossed 15 crore with one crore tests added in just 10 days, the Union Health Ministry said underlining comprehensive and widespread testing on a sustained basis has resulted in bringing down the positivity rate, reports PTI.
Tokyo's daily coronavirus cases top 600 for first time
The number of new coronavirus infections in Japan’s capital topped 600 in a day for the first time Thursday, while experts warned of the increased burden on hospitals, reports AP.

Russia reports 27,927 new Covid-19 cases
Russia confirmed 27,927 new coronavirus cases in the last 24 hours on Thursday, pushing the national tally to 2,569,126, reports Reuters.
Israel to begin mass Covid-19 vaccination by end December
Israel is scheduled to start a mass vaccination campaign against the novel coronavirus on December 27,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u said late on Wednesday, reports ANI/Sputnik.

Pfizer Covid-19 vaccine faces last hurdle before US decision
Pfizer's Covid-19 vaccine faces one final hurdle as it races to become the first shot greenlighted in the US: a panel of experts who will scrutinize the company's data for any red flags, reports Ap.
Telangana records 643 new Covid cases
A total of 643 new Covid-19 cases, and 02 deaths have been reported in Telangana. The state Health Department said the state's coronavirus count has increased to 2,75,904 which includes 2,66,925 discharges, reports ANI.
Covid-19 cases in Mexico top 1.2 million mark
The number of registered cases of the novel coronavirus disease (Covid-19) in Mexico has surpassed 1.2 million, with more than 111,000 deaths, a senior health official said, reports ANI/Sputnik.
Germany records 23,679 new Covid-19 cases
The number of confirmed coronavirus cases in Germany increased by 23,679 to 1,242,203, data from the Robert Koch Institute (RKI) for infectious diseases showed on Thursday. The reported death toll rose by 440 to 20,372, the tally showed, reports Reuters.
